How long to cook a 22 lb stuffed turkey?

It's impossible to give you an exact cooking time for a 22 lb stuffed turkey without more information! Here's why:

* Oven Temperature: Different ovens cook at slightly different temperatures.

* Stuffing Type: A stuffing made with bread will cook differently than a stuffing with rice.

* Turkey Size and Shape: A 22 lb turkey could be long and thin or round and compact.

Here's how to figure out your cooking time:

1. Use a Meat Thermometer: The most accurate way to ensure your turkey is cooked through is to use a meat thermometer. The turkey is safe to eat when the intern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C) in the thickest part of the thigh.

2. Follow a Reliable Recipe: Find a recipe that specifically calls for a 22 lb turkey and provides cooking times.

3. Estimate Cooking Time: As a rough estimate, a 22 lb turkey will likely take around 4-5 hours to cook at 325°F (165°C). However, this is just a starting point.

4. Check for Doneness: Start checking the internal temperature after about 3 hours. Continue checking every 30-45 minutes until the turkey reaches the safe temperature.

Important Tips:

* Don't Stuff Beforehand: Stuff the turkey right before roasting for food safety reasons.

* Rest the Turkey: After the turkey is cooked, let it rest for at least 20 minutes before carving to allow the juices to redistribute.
